I never had trouble running the game, except for the copy protection thing. It was easily bypassed using the official fix.

The graphics in Painkiller are good not only from a technical point of view but from an artistic point of view as well, except, arguably, for the first chapter. People Can Fly managed to make Purgatory look very varied and appropriately enough, chaotic. Some of the levels are just amazing to look at, like the opera house and the abandoned factory. The final level is also very original and memorable. The creepy ambient music gives the game an equally creepy atmosphere, although it sure isn't Doom 3/Undying/System Shock 2 scary. The game also sports an awesome physics engine.

The gameplay is pretty much like Serious Sam: old school, simple and hectic. I didn't thing it was a bad thing, but I'm pretty open as far as video games go :):
